1. Penetration Testing (Pen-Testing)
This is the most common kind of private service. Specialists replicate a real-world cyberattack to find "holes" in a business's network, applications, or hardware.
2. Social Engineering Audits
Technology is seldom the only weak spot; individuals are typically the simplest point of entry. Confidential hackers carry out phishing simulations and "vishing" (voice phishing) to evaluate how well a company's staff members stick to security procedures.
3. Digital Forensics and Incident Response
Following a breach, a personal service may be worked with to trace the origin of the attack, identify what information was accessed, and help the client recuperate lost possessions without alerting the general public or the attacker.

Is it legal to hire a hacker?
Yes, it is entirely legal to [Hire Black Hat Hacker](https://doc.adminforge.de/s/nVDYVbXTAe) a hacker for "White Hat" purposes, such as testing your own systems or recovering your own information. It is unlawful to hire someone to access a system or account that you do not own or have written authorization to test.
2. How much do private hacker services cost?
Pricing differs hugely based upon scope. A simple web application pentest might cost between ₤ 2,000 and ₤ 10,000, while a full-scale business "Red Team" engagement can go beyond ₤ 50,000.
3. The length of time does a typical engagement take?
A standard security audit usually takes in between one to 3 weeks. Complex engagements including social engineering or physical security testing might take several months.
4. What accreditations should I search for?
Search for professionals with certificates such as OSCP (Offensive Security Certified Professional), CISSP (Certified Information Systems Security Professional), or CEH (Certified Ethical Hacker).
5. Will they have access to my delicate information?
Possibly. This is why the agreement and NDA are essential. Professional services focus on the vulnerability rather than the information. They prove they could access the information without really downloading or storing it.
